Biografia

Bunny Wailer, born Neville O'Riley Livingston (1947-2021), was a Jamaican singer and percussionist considered one of the pillars of reggae. A founding member of The Wailers alongside Bob Marley and Peter Tosh, he significantly contributed to the birth and evolution of this musical genre. After the band's split, Bunny Wailer embarked on a successful solo career, earning numerous accolades, including three Grammy Awards. His music is characterized by deep Rastafarian spirituality, poetic lyrics, and engaging rhythms. Among his most representative tracks: "Blackheart Man", "Dreamland" and "Here Comes Trouble". Bunny Wailer was an iconic figure in the world of reggae, whose legacy continues to inspire generations of musicians.
